diff options
| author | Martin Rudalics | 2007-10-12 06:23:43 +0000 |
|---|---|---|
| committer | Martin Rudalics | 2007-10-12 06:23:43 +0000 |
| commit | af84194a20f63b9ac08f35fd02d6d8a41f883729 (patch) | |
| tree | 87aee877e482eec590e31b3f5f57b02dafbef686 | |
| parent | 1663d0b8f8ec5ba33ea9b04664a40343674cf9fa (diff) | |
| download | emacs-af84194a20f63b9ac08f35fd02d6d8a41f883729.tar.gz emacs-af84194a20f63b9ac08f35fd02d6d8a41f883729.zip | |
(handle-select-window): Revert part of 2007-10-08
change setting the input focus.
| -rw-r--r-- | lisp/ChangeLog | 5 | ||||
| -rw-r--r-- | lisp/window.el | 4 |
2 files changed, 5 insertions, 4 deletions
diff --git a/lisp/ChangeLog b/lisp/ChangeLog index 2fed711f6d7..8c07699c823 100644 --- a/lisp/ChangeLog +++ b/lisp/ChangeLog | |||
| @@ -1,3 +1,8 @@ | |||
| 1 | 2007-10-12 Martin Rudalics <rudalics@gmx.at> | ||
| 2 | |||
| 3 | * window.el (handle-select-window): Revert part of 2007-10-08 | ||
| 4 | change setting the input focus. | ||
| 5 | |||
| 1 | 2007-10-12 Glenn Morris <rgm@gnu.org> | 6 | 2007-10-12 Glenn Morris <rgm@gnu.org> |
| 2 | 7 | ||
| 3 | * emacs-lisp/byte-opt.el (top level): | 8 | * emacs-lisp/byte-opt.el (top level): |
diff --git a/lisp/window.el b/lisp/window.el index 41aa5aea06b..0f6ae8ab763 100644 --- a/lisp/window.el +++ b/lisp/window.el | |||
| @@ -1019,10 +1019,6 @@ active. This function is run by `mouse-autoselect-window-timer'." | |||
| 1019 | (when mouse-autoselect-window | 1019 | (when mouse-autoselect-window |
| 1020 | ;; Reset state of delayed autoselection. | 1020 | ;; Reset state of delayed autoselection. |
| 1021 | (setq mouse-autoselect-window-state nil) | 1021 | (setq mouse-autoselect-window-state nil) |
| 1022 | ;; Set input focus to handle cross-frame movement. Bind | ||
| 1023 | ;; `focus-follows-mouse' to avoid moving the mouse cursor. | ||
| 1024 | (let (focus-follows-mouse) | ||
| 1025 | (select-frame-set-input-focus (window-frame window))) | ||
| 1026 | ;; Run `mouse-leave-buffer-hook' when autoselecting window. | 1022 | ;; Run `mouse-leave-buffer-hook' when autoselecting window. |
| 1027 | (run-hooks 'mouse-leave-buffer-hook)) | 1023 | (run-hooks 'mouse-leave-buffer-hook)) |
| 1028 | (select-window window)))) | 1024 | (select-window window)))) |